Barefoot Sanctuary

Snuggled inside the Whole Foods Market at Town Square, just south of the Strip, there is an intimate space right above the shoppers heads where crazy things like handstand and acro-fit classes are going on, groovy vibes, cool music, yoga, meditations, belly dancing, tribal dancing…it’s hard to imagine a fitness studio inside Whole Foods…or is it?  And, the studio owners, Jaime and Alvin Tam, are amazingly beautiful people with vibrant souls and energy.  Definitely a must-see, must attend studio before you head back home.  (Even if home is Summerlin or Henderson!)

Blue Sky Yoga

You can’t miss this studio when visiting Las Vegas.  Located inside the Arts Factory in Downtown Las Vegas (yes, the real Downtown, the Strip is actually not Downtown), Cheryl Slader’s Blue Sky Yoga is a donation based yoga studio offering some of the most amazing classes and workshops in Las Vegas.  What makes this place a must-see is the funky and cool atmosphere that surrounds it.  Depending on the month and the artist, the studio itself is an actual art gallery displaying local artists’ work.  It is a small, intimate space, so make sure you arrive early to park your mat.  If you are looking for something different to take the fam to, check out First Fridays which is a local artist, musician, vendor, culinary hot spot with lots of stimulation and visual aesthetics.  Click here for Blue Sky Yoga July Events.
